Pasadena, located in the picturesque state of California, is a vibrant city known for its rich cultural heritage, stunning architecture, and diverse community. Nestled in Los Angeles County, Pasadena boasts a unique blend of historical charm and modern amenities. Famous for hosting the annual Tournament of Roses Parade and the Rose Bowl Game, the city offers a range of cultural and recreational activities. Its tree-lined streets, upscale neighborhoods, and proximity to the San Gabriel Mountains make Pasadena an attractive place to live and explore.

Costs of Home Health Care in Pasadena:

Home health care costs in Pasadena, CA, can vary based on factors such as the level of care required, the specific services needed, and the provider chosen. Generally, the city's affluent status may influence the cost of services, with rates potentially higher than the national average. It's advisable for residents to explore different providers, consider insurance coverage, and inquire about payment options to make informed decisions regarding home health care costs in Pasadena.
